The Purrfect Passage: Why Hiring a Professional Cat Access Door Installer is a Smart Move

For cat fans, offering their feline buddies with flexibility and self-reliance is typically a top concern. Cat access doors, also called cat flaps or pet doors, use a fantastic solution, permitting cats to come and go as they please, venturing into the great outdoors or retreating indoors for safety and comfort. While the idea appears uncomplicated, the installation of a cat access door is not constantly an easy DIY job. This is where the competence of a professional cat access door installer becomes important.

What Does a Cat Access Door Installer Actually Do?

The process of setting up a affordable cat flap installation door by a professional is more than just cutting a hole and placing a flap. It's a comprehensive service developed to guarantee ideal functionality and visual combination.

Here's a normal breakdown of what a cat door installer will do:

  1. Consultation and Assessment: The process typically starts with a consultation. The installer will discuss your requirements, assess your existing doors or walls, and identify the very best area and kind of cat door for your home and your modern cat flap installation. They will consider elements like door material, density, and the existence of any wiring or plumbing that may be affected.
  2. Door Selection Guidance: If you haven't already picked a cat door, the installer can provide assistance on picking the best type. They can encourage on features like flap type (standard, magnetic, microchip), size, and product, ensuring it suits your cat's size and your security preferences. They may even use a range of doors for you to choose from.
  3. Accurate Measurement and Marking: Accurate measurements are important for a successful installation. The installer will carefully measure the door or wall and mark the precise area for the cat door opening, considering the producer's specs and ensuring it is at the appropriate height for your cat.
  4. Cutting and Installation: Using specialized tools, the installer will thoroughly cut the opening in your selected location. Whether it's a wooden door, glass panel, or wall, they will employ the appropriate strategies to ensure a clean and accurate cut. They will then set up the adjustable cat flap installation door frame and secure it strongly in place.
  5. Sealing and Weatherproofing: A vital step is guaranteeing the cat door is appropriately sealed and weatherproofed. The installer will utilize appropriate sealants to prevent drafts, water ingress, and insect entry around the door frame, keeping the energy efficiency and convenience of your home.
  6. Clean-up and Demonstration: Once the installation is total, a professional installer will clean up the work area, removing any particles and ensuring your home is left tidy. They will also show the performance of the cat door, explaining any features and using guidance on how to train your cat to utilize it, if needed.

Types of Cat Access Doors and Installation Locations:

Professional installers are skilled in handling a range of cat door types and installation places. This versatility is another crucial advantage of hiring an expert.

Here are some common types of cat doors and areas installers can work with:

Types of Cat Doors:

  • Standard Flap Doors: These are simple, cost-effective doors with a flexible flap that the cat pushes through.
  • Magnetic Cat Doors: These doors need the cat to wear a magnetic collar, avoiding undesirable animals from getting in.
  • Microchip Cat Doors: These are the most safe and secure and sophisticated options, reading your cat's microchip to permit entry only to your pet, keeping out stray animals and maintaining home security.
  • Tunnel Cat Doors: Designed for thicker walls or doors, these doors use a tunnel extension to bridge the gap.

Installation Locations/Materials:

  • Wooden Doors: The most typical installation location. Installers are experienced in cutting and fitting doors into numerous types of wood doors, consisting of strong core and hollow core.
  • Glass Doors and Windows: Installing cat door for wooden door (http://v0795.com/home.php?mod=space&uid=2342615) doors in glass requires specialized skills and tools. Specialists can safely cut circular or rectangle-shaped holes in glass panels, guaranteeing structural integrity and a clean finish.
  • Walls: For more discreet access, cat doors can be installed in walls, typically leading to basements or garages. This requires expertise in wall building and framing.
  • Patio Doors and Sliding Doors: Installers can fit cat doors into existing patio area doors or sliding glass doors, often by replacing a glass panel with one pre-cut for a pet door.
  • Screen Doors: Mesh screen doors can also accommodate cat doors, permitting ventilation while offering pet access.

Cost Considerations for Professional Installation:

The cost of professional cat door installation can vary depending on several aspects:

  • Type of Cat Door: More sophisticated doors like microchip models may have a somewhat greater installation cost due to their intricacy.
  • Installation Location and Material: Installing in glass or walls is normally more complicated and may cost more than installing in a basic wooden door.
  • Complexity of the Job: If adjustments to the door frame or surrounding structure are needed, this can increase the overall cost.
  • Installer's Rates and Location: Installer rates can vary depending on their experience, place, and local market value.

It's always best to get a detailed quote from the installer before continuing, laying out all costs involved.
